Lionel Messi Becomes Second Billionaire Footballer

Lionel Messi became the second-richest footballer in the world as his earnings came more than $1 billion this year, according to Forbes.

Last June, Portuguese superstar Cristiano Ronaldo became the first footballer in the world to become a billionaire. It took only three months for his arch-rival Messi to touch Ronaldo. Messi, the six-time Ballon d’Or-winning Argentine star, also became the sixth billionaire in the world.

Earlier, Michael Jordan in basketball, Tiger Woods in golf, Floyd Mayweather in pro-boxing, Michael Schumacher in formula racing and Cristiano Ronaldo in football surpassed 1 billion.

Barcelona captain Messi has also become the highest-paid footballer this year on his way to becoming a billionaire. In addition to $92 million he received from Spanish club Barcelona, he earned $34 million in 2020 from other advertising deals.

Ronaldo has earned just 9 million euros less than Messi this year. According to Forbes, the Juventus forward earned $117 million in 2020. Besides, no other footballer has been able to earn $100 million this year.
